Address

RC8LVu8PejVfzpRQ8bDXxv9jMhur3K9ErWCopy

Total Received

6238.94559296 KMD

Total Sent

6237.65168967 KMD

№ Transactions

2335

Final Balance

1.29390329 KMD

Transactions
Filter